Advantages of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ums offer a lot of benefits around traditional vacuum cleaners. Firstly, they provide remarkable suction electrical power, making sure a deeper clean up for carpets, rugs, and tough flooring. The central unit is often located in a garage or basement, faraway from living parts, which considerably lessens noise degrees throughout Procedure. In addition, central vacuums strengthen indoor air high quality by venting dust and allergens exterior, making them a fantastic choice for allergy sufferers.

One more important reward is benefit. With central vacuums, you only will need to carry a light-weight hose and attachment rather than lugging close to a major unit. This simplicity of use is especially helpful in multi-Tale houses. Also, central vacuums can increase the resale worth of a house, as They're regarded a premium characteristic by quite a few purchasers.

Parts of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ums encompass a number of critical components. The ability device, which includes the motor and dirt canister, could be the core in the process. This unit is usually put in in a remote spot, for instance a garage or basement. Subsequent, a community of PVC tubing operates through the walls of the house, connecting to inlet valves strategically positioned in several rooms. These valves allow you to plug inside the hose and attachments to entry the vacuum's suction ability.

The method also involves several different attachments and add-ons, for example brushes, crevice applications, and power heads, created for various cleansing tasks. Some central vacuum techniques feature a retractable hose, that may be stored inside the wall when not in use, incorporating to your convenience.

Installation Approach

Setting up central vacuums within an existing residence calls for some scheduling and professional knowledge. The method commences with pinpointing the very best area for the ability device and scheduling the tubing route. The installation normally includes functioning PVC pipes through the walls, attic, or crawl spaces to connect the ability device into the inlet valves.

Servicing Recommendations

Protecting central vacuums is relatively easy and entails several essential techniques. On a regular basis vacant the dust canister or switch the vacuum bag, based on the model. Thoroughly clean or substitute the filters to keep up ideal suction electricity and make sure the technique's longevity. Periodically Test the hose and attachments for blockages and put on, and inspect the inlet valves and tubing for just about any leaks or injury.

By adhering to these upkeep ideas, it is possible to assure your central vacuum process operates successfully and proceeds to offer remarkable cleansing effectiveness for quite some time.
